Grass seed is commonly offered as a mix of species for a particular increasing condition or mix of ailments. For instance, you could look for a grass seed blend for shade and dry circumstances or a combination for full Solar and high foot visitors. Go through the packaging carefully to choose the appropriate seed in your individual web page.

Want an expensive lawn? Installing sod can completely transform any yard in as tiny to be a weekend. Sod is actually a layer of pre-developed grass that arrives on pallets and is laid on the Grime within your lawn. With the right care, this transplanted grass can take root and thrives. How often you mow and the height at which you chop grass can have an affect on lawn wellness. Make sure you concentrate to blade sharpness; cutting the lawn with dull mower blades shreds grass blades and can introduce disorders.

Develop a cooling impact throughout warm climate. On the hot summer months working day, a lawn might be at least 30 levels Fahrenheit cooler than asphalt and 14 degrees Fahrenheit cooler than bare soil.
